Nucleus RTOS برای چیست و چگونه کار می کند؟
Nucleus RTOS یا Real-Time Operating System یک پلت فرم نرم افزاری تخصصی است که برای سیستم های جاسازی شده بلادرنگ طراحی شده است. این سیستم ها نیاز به کنترل دقیق بر اجرای وظایف دارند و Nucleus RTOS را به یک انتخاب محبوب در صنایعی مانند مخابرات، خودروسازی، تجهیزات پزشکی و اتوماسیون صنعتی تبدیل می کند. اما Nucleus RTOS دقیقا برای چه چیزی استفاده می شود و چگونه کار می کند؟
ویژگی های کلیدی Nucleus RTOS:
برای درک کاربرد آن، درک ویژگی های کلیدی که Nucleus RTOS را تعریف می کند ضروری است:
-
مدیریت کارها: Nucleus RTOS در مدیریت چندین کار به طور همزمان عالی است. زمان CPU را بر اساس اولویت به وظایف اختصاص می دهد و اطمینان حاصل می کند که عملکردهای حیاتی مورد توجه فوری قرار می گیرند.
-
مدیریت وقفه: سیستم های بلادرنگ اغلب نیاز دارند تا به رویدادهای سخت افزاری به سرعت پاسخ دهند. Nucleus RTOS به طور موثر وقفه ها را کنترل می کند و تاخیر را به حداقل می رساند.
-
مدیریت حافظه: تخصیص و تخصیص حافظه برای سیستم های تعبیه شده بسیار مهم است. Nucleus RTOS مدیریت قوی حافظه را فراهم می کند و از نشت و تکه تکه شدن حافظه جلوگیری می کند.
-
ارتباطات بین فرآیندی: ارتباط بین وظایف و فرآیندها برای عملیات هماهنگ ضروری است. Nucleus RTOS مکانیسم هایی مانند صف های پیام، سمافورها و پرچم های رویداد را برای تسهیل IPC ارائه می دهد.
-
تایمر و ساعت: زمان بندی دقیق مشخصه سیستم های بلادرنگ است. Nucleus RTOS شامل تایمرها و ساعت ها برای برنامه ریزی وظایف با دقت بالا است.
-
درایورهای دستگاه: سیستم های جاسازی شده با اجزای سخت افزاری مختلف تعامل دارند. Nucleus RTOS از درایورهای دستگاه برای ادغام یکپارچه سخت افزار پشتیبانی می کند.
-
مقیاس پذیری: چه پروژه شما کوچک باشد و چه بزرگ، Nucleus RTOS به طور موثر مقیاس می شود و با الزامات برنامه تعبیه شده شما سازگار می شود.
چرا برای Nucleus RTOS به پروکسی نیاز دارید؟
در حالی که Nucleus RTOS به دلیل قابلیت های بلادرنگ خود مشهور است، سناریوهایی وجود دارد که استفاده از یک سرور پراکسی سودمند می شود. پروکسی ها به عنوان واسطه بین سیستم تعبیه شده شما و منابع خارجی عمل می کنند و یک لایه اضافی از کنترل و امنیت را معرفی می کنند. به همین دلیل ممکن است برای Nucleus RTOS به یک پروکسی نیاز داشته باشید:
1. کنترل دسترسی:
- پراکسی ها می توانند دسترسی به منابع خاص را محدود کنند و فقط به دستگاه ها یا برنامه های مجاز اجازه می دهند با سرورهای خارجی ارتباط برقرار کنند. این امر امنیت را افزایش می دهد و از دسترسی غیرمجاز جلوگیری می کند.
2. ناشناس بودن:
- در برنامه های خاص، حفظ ناشناس بودن بسیار مهم است. پراکسیها میتوانند منشأ درخواستها را پنهان کنند و ردیابی مکان یا هویت سیستم شما را برای نهادهای خارجی چالش برانگیز میکنند.
3. تعادل بار:
- پروکسی ها می توانند درخواست ها را بین چندین سرور توزیع کنند، استفاده از منابع را بهینه کرده و عملکرد سیستم را بهبود بخشند. این به ویژه در برنامه هایی با بار ترافیکی بالا مفید است.
4. فیلتر محتوا:
- پروکسی ها می توانند داده های ورودی و خروجی را فیلتر کنند، محتوای نامطلوب را مسدود کنند و اطمینان حاصل کنند که سیستم جاسازی شده شما فقط با منابع قابل اعتماد تعامل دارد.
مزایای استفاده از پروکسی با Nucleus RTOS
ادغام یک سرور پراکسی با Nucleus RTOS چندین مزیت دارد:
1. امنیت پیشرفته:
- پروکسی ها یک لایه امنیتی اضافی اضافه می کنند و از سیستم تعبیه شده شما در برابر حملات مخرب و دسترسی غیرمجاز محافظت می کنند.
2. بهبود عملکرد:
- مکانیسمهای متعادلسازی بار و حافظه پنهان در پراکسیها میتوانند استفاده از منابع را بهینه کرده و تأخیر را کاهش دهند و در نتیجه عملکرد سیستم را بهبود بخشند.
3. ناشناس بودن و حریم خصوصی:
- پروکسی ها می توانند آدرس IP سیستم شما را مخفی کنند، ناشناس بودن را افزایش داده و از اطلاعات حساس محافظت می کنند.
4. کنترل محتوا:
- پروکسی ها فیلتر محتوا را فعال می کنند و به شما امکان می دهند محتوای ناخواسته را مسدود کنید و اطمینان حاصل کنید که سیستم شما با منابع قابل اعتماد تعامل دارد.
5. دسترسی به محتوای جغرافیایی محدود:
- پراکسیهایی با قابلیت مکانیابی جغرافیایی میتوانند به منابع خاص منطقه دسترسی داشته باشند و دامنه دسترسی سیستم تعبیهشده شما را افزایش دهند.
مزایای استفاده از پراکسی های رایگان برای Nucleus RTOS چیست؟
در حالی که پراکسی های رایگان ممکن است وسوسه انگیز به نظر برسند، اما هنگام استفاده با Nucleus RTOS دارای اشکالات قابل توجهی هستند:
اشکال | توضیح |
---|---|
عملکرد غیر قابل اعتماد | پروکسی های رایگان اغلب از سرعت پایین و خرابی رنج می برند. |
خطرات امنیتی | آنها ممکن است اقدامات امنیتی قوی ارائه نکنند و سیستم شما را در معرض تهدیدات بالقوه قرار دهند. |
ویژگی های محدود | پروکسیهای رایگان ممکن است فاقد ویژگیهای پیشرفته مانند تعادل بار و فیلتر محتوا باشند. |
نگرانی های حفظ حریم خصوصی داده ها | برخی از پراکسیهای رایگان ممکن است فعالیت شما را ثبت کنند و نگرانیهایی در مورد حفظ حریم خصوصی ایجاد کنند. |
در دسترس بودن غیر قابل پیش بینی | سرورهای پروکسی رایگان ممکن است بیش از حد شلوغ باشند و ممکن است همیشه در صورت نیاز در دسترس نباشند. |
بهترین پروکسی ها برای Nucleus RTOS کدامند؟
انتخاب سرور پراکسی مناسب برای Nucleus RTOS برای عملکرد و امنیت بهینه بسیار مهم است. هنگام انتخاب پروکسی به فاکتورهای زیر توجه کنید:
فاکتوری که باید در نظر گرفته شود | توضیح |
---|---|
قابلیت اطمینان | اطمینان حاصل کنید که پروکسی عملکرد قابل اعتماد و ثابتی را ارائه می دهد. |
ویژگی های امنیتی | برای محافظت از سیستم خود به دنبال پروکسی هایی با اقدامات امنیتی قوی باشید. |
بهینه سازی عملکرد | پروکسیهایی با ویژگیهایی مانند متعادلسازی بار و ذخیرهسازی حافظه پنهان میتوانند عملکرد را افزایش دهند. |
حفاظت از حریم خصوصی | پراکسی هایی را انتخاب کنید که حریم خصوصی و ناشناس بودن داده ها را در اولویت قرار می دهند. |
پشتیبانی و نگهداری | پروکسی هایی را انتخاب کنید که با پشتیبانی پاسخگو و به روز رسانی های منظم پشتیبانی می شوند. |
چگونه یک سرور پروکسی را برای Nucleus RTOS پیکربندی کنیم؟
پیکربندی یک سرور پراکسی برای Nucleus RTOS شامل چندین مرحله است:
-
یک سرور پروکسی را انتخاب کنید: یک پروکسی سرور مناسب بر اساس نیازهای خاص خود انتخاب کنید.
-
نصب نرم افزارهای لازم: هر نرم افزار یا درایور مورد نیاز برای اتصال دستگاه Nucleus RTOS خود را به سرور پراکسی انتخابی نصب کنید.
-
پیکربندی تنظیمات شبکه: تنظیمات شبکه را در دستگاه Nucleus RTOS خود برای هدایت ترافیک از طریق سرور پراکسی تنظیم کنید. این ممکن است شامل تعیین آدرس IP و پورت سرور پراکسی باشد.
-
احراز هویت: در صورت نیاز، تنظیمات احراز هویت را برای اطمینان از ارتباط ایمن بین دستگاه خود و سرور پراکسی پیکربندی کنید.
-
آزمایش کردن: پیکربندی را آزمایش کنید تا مطمئن شوید که دستگاه Nucleus RTOS شما به درستی از سرور پراکسی برای ارتباط استفاده می کند.
در نتیجه، Nucleus RTOS یک سیستم عامل قدرتمند بلادرنگ است که در صنایع مختلف استفاده می شود و یکپارچه سازی یک سرور پروکسی می تواند امنیت، عملکرد و عملکرد آن را افزایش دهد. با این حال، با در نظر گرفتن عواملی مانند قابلیت اطمینان، امنیت و بهینه سازی عملکرد، انتخاب یک پروکسی قابل اعتماد بسیار مهم است. پیکربندی مناسب ارتباط یکپارچه بین Nucleus RTOS و سرور پراکسی انتخابی را تضمین می کند و مزایای این ادغام را به حداکثر می رساند.